Spain Arrests Members of Hells Angels Motorcycle Club

Police in Spain arrested 25 members of the Hells Angels motorcycle gang on the Spanish resort island of Mallorca.

The charges included drug trafficking, trafficking in human beings, extortion, money laundering and corruption.

The motorcycle gang, which has more than 100 chapters in 29 countries, is considered an organized crime syndicate by the US Department of Justice.
